8. You're at a romantic beach with hot girls and 10 coco palms in a row, the palm trees planted in increasing size, i.e., palm tree 9 is the highest one, palm tree 0 is the lowest one. Each palm tree has exactly one coconut hanging from it. You pick one palm tree to climb. If someone else chooses the same palm tree,you brawl for the coconut and everyone falls down that tree. If you're alone on your tree, you must choose a palm tree to throw your coconut at, but you can only throw your coconut at a tree of lower height, i.e., one with lower number. (So if you're on tree 0, you cannot throw your coconut). You all throw simultaneously, and if your tree is hit by a coconut, you fall down the tree. The players that haven't fallen off their tree at that point get points. The lower the palm tree, the closer your view at the hot girls at the beach. Therefore the remaining player in lowest position gets 1.0 points, the one in second lowest position 0.8 points, and so on. Which tree do you pick to climb, and which tree (which must have lower number) do you throw you coconut at if you get the chance?

Here's how the palm trees are occupied, in brackets is the palm tree the respective player aimed at with his coconut.
0
1
2 Ramon (0)
3
4 ccexplore (3), Clam Spammer (3)
5 Gronkling (3), RubiX (3)
6 Lem Steven (5), geoo (2)
7 Insane Steve (2), Simon (1)
8 möbius (2) [changed from palm tree 2, throw at (1)]
9
Palm trees 4 to 7 are occupied by 2 players each, so only Ramon on palm tree 2 and möbius on palm tree 8 remain.
möbius however aimed at tree 2 with his coconut, so Ramon falls down and möbius is the only one remaining on a tree, not exactly having the most excellent view on the girls, nevertheless gaining 1 point.
(möbius changed his guesses once, including for this game, and here it was a good choice, as otherwise no-one would have won)


9. There are four safes, each containing points. You want to steal the content, but there is one issue. Each safe has an elaborate security mechanism, which can only be broken by kicking against it really hard for a certain number of times. However you can only kick once, as afterwards your feet hurt too much to dare another kick. So the players picking the same safe to crack have to work together. Each player can kick the safe, but they can also be smart and choose not to kick, just waiting at the safe watching the others do it. If the safe opens, you share the loot, but those whose feet don't hurt are quicker to prey the safe, so they get twice as much as the other ones. If the safe doesn't open because too few people kicked against it, you get nothing. Which safe do you pick, and do you choose to kick against it or just wait beside it and watch the others do it?

#1: 1 kicks, 1.0 points - kicking: Insane Steve, Gronkling (0.25 points), waiting: ccexplore (0.5 points)
#2: 2 kicks, 2.4 points - kicking: Lem Steven, Simon, geoo (0.48 points), waiting: Clam Spammer (0.96 points)
#3: 3 kicks, 4.2 points - kicking: Ramon, waiting: RubiX
#4: 4 kicks, 6.0 points - kicking: möbius (changed from waiting)

Only few players were reckless enough to try to crack open the third and fourth save, but don't get rewarded as it doesn't budge. The cowards win, but don't get too much overall.
